Prayer Requests

1. Pray for the expanding and strengthening of the Body of Christ. God's people face extreme challenges living in a society emerging from centuries of systems characterized by violence, domination, deception, and corruption. Pray that believers will become mighty in spirit. Pray that true believers will discover the right, the authority, and the power they have available to pray for a city the size of Kiev.

2. Pray that God will do whatever is necessary to bring spiritual unity among believers. You can have unity without agreement, because unity is built on love, and not on doctrine. Pray that churches will understand that they can pray together and love each other without agreeing on every doctrine. Pray that they will see how love covers. Pray that churches will see that it is love for one another that the world sees as a testimony to the Gospel.

3. Pray for church leaders, that they will focus on the basics of the Gospel and the essential needs of ministry. Pray that they will love their churches with that which only Jesus can provide. Pray that they will not hold them in legalistic bondage by preaching intimidating performance, and pray that they will understand and proclaim the grace of God that sets captives free. Pray that they will be true to God's Word, filled and anointed by the Holy Spirit, and bold and courageous in their ministries.

4. Pray that truth, integrity, and purity will rise up in the church, that believers will be set free from the temptation to compromise, and that truth, integrity, and purity will be released into the community in a way that will change the way it thinks and acts.

5. Pray that pastors and other leaders will have a vital personal prayer life. Pray that God will put it in the hearts of members that prayer is the key to seeing a city change. Pray that churches in Kiev will make praying for their city a major priority in their ministries.

6. Pray that pastors, churches, and denominations will become more interested in building the Kingdom of Christ than in building their own kingdoms. Pray that pastors and ministry leaders will actively search for ways to pray together for the city.

7. Pray for the salvation of many people in Kiev. A growing number of churches are becoming more strongly evangelistic and mission minded. There are numerous missionary agencies headquartered in the city. Pray that God will use them all to draw thousands to His Son.

8. Pray for President Kuchma, all national leaders, the national Parliament, the city's mayor and all local authorities. Scripture says doing so results in a peaceable and tranquil society (I Tim 2:1-4).

9. Pray that God will motivate His people from all around the world to begin praying for Kiev on a regular basis.
